What does a remote account payable manager do?

A Remote Account Payable Manager oversees the accounts payable department of an organization while working from a remote location. Their main responsibilities include managing invoice processing, ensuring timely payments to vendors, reconciling accounts, and implementing policies to streamline payment procedures. They also supervise accounts payable staff, maintain accurate financial records, and ensure compliance with company and legal standards. Effective communication and organizational skills are essential, as the manager coordinates with other departments and external partners virtually.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ote account payable manager?

To thrive as a Remote Account Payable Manager, you need a strong background in accounting principles, experience with accounts payable processes, and often a bachelor’s degree in accounting or finance. Familiarity with ERP systems like SAP or Oracle, advanced Excel skills, and sometimes certification such as a CPA or CMA are typically required. Excellent organizational skills, attention to detail, and the ability to communicate effectively with both internal and external stakeholders set top performers apart. These skills and qualifications ensure accurate, timely processing of payments, compliance with financial regulations, and smooth remote team collaboration.

What are some common challenges faced by a remote account payable manager, and how can they be effectively addressed?

A Remote Accounts Payable Manager often encounters challenges such as ensuring timely invoice approvals, maintaining clear communication with dispersed teams, and safeguarding sensitive financial data. Overcoming these challenges typically involves leveraging secure, cloud-based AP automation tools, establishing standardized workflows, and scheduling regular virtual check-ins with both the AP team and internal stakeholders. Proactively fostering a culture of transparency and accountability also helps maintain accuracy and efficiency in remote environments.

What is the difference between Remote Account Payable Manager vs Remote Accounts Payable Specialist?

AspectRemote Account Payable ManagerRemote Accounts Payable Specialist
CredentialsTypically requires accounting or finance degree, experience in accounts payable, and leadership skillsUsually requires basic accounting knowledge, certification like AP or bookkeeping experience
Work EnvironmentOversees AP team, manages processes, and ensures compliancePerforms invoice processing, data entry, and vendor communication
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in finance, corporate, and large organizationsFound in similar industries, often in support or administrative roles

The main difference is that the Remote Account Payable Manager oversees the AP team and manages processes, while the Remote Accounts Payable Specialist handles invoice processing and vendor interactions. The manager role involves leadership and strategic oversight, whereas the specialist focuses on day-to-day transaction tasks.
